About This Artist
Elecktra
4,305 listeners
The roots of Elecktra can be traced to Madrid, circa 1994. “No Flowers Field” (as the band was known in those days) started its public appearances around Madrid, sharing the stage with groups such as Sôber in intimate venues. In 2001 the band changed its name to Elecktra, but it was not until 2002 that the group was definitely completed.
